Prometheus is an open-source monitoring system that was originally built by SoundCloud.It consists of the following core components - A data scraper that pulls metrics data over HTTP periodically at a configured interval.. A time-series database to store all the metrics data.. A simple user interface where you can visualize, query, and monitor all the metrics. and alerting are not possible with aggregation.
